Just an little information for a start: the name is Amarok, not amaroK, and that has changed in 2006 already
![]() The cover fetching from Google is broken currently since Google changed their API so only covers from last.fm do work currently. If your wikipedia applet doesn't work that would be a totally different issue, please check your network connection, something must have gone wrong there. Maybe just restarting Amarok could help.
